Abstract
INTRODUCTION: The diagnostic accuracy of antigen testing of anterior nasal (AN) samples for the severe acute respiratory syndrome coronavirus 2 (SARS-CoV-2) infection has not been evaluated in the Japanese population. This study assessed the diagnostic accuracy of the Roche SARS-CoV-2 rapid antigen test (rapid antigen test) using AN samples.Entities:

Comparison of the results of the SARS-CoV-2 Rapid Antigen Test (rapid antigen test) using anterior nasal samples and the real-time reverse-transcription polymerase chain reaction using nasopharyngeal samples among all participants.
| NP real-time RT-PCR (NIID) | |||
|---|---|---|---|
| Positive | Negative | ||
| Rapid antigen test | Positive | 80 | 0 |
| Negative | 30 | 690 | |
| Sensitivity (%) | 72.7 (63.4–80.8) | ||
| Specificity (%) | 100 (99.5–100) | ||
| Positive predictive value (%) | 100 (95.5–100) | ||
| Negative predictive value (%) | 95.8 (94.1–97.1) | ||
The Cohen's Kappa coefficient between the two tests was 0.82.
The sensitivity, specificity, positive predictive value, and negative predictive value are presented with their 95% confidence intervals.
CI, confidence intervals; NIID, National Institute of Infectious Diseases, Japan; NP, nasopharyngeal; RT-PCR, reverse-transcription polymerase chain reaction.

Sensitivity of the SARS-CoV-2 Rapid Antigen Test (rapid antigen test) according to the Ct value.
| Sensitivity (%) | |||
|---|---|---|---|
| Ct value | N | Rapid antigen test | AN RT-PCR |
| <20 | 49 | 93.9 (83.1–98.7) | 95.9 (86.0–99.5) |
| 20–25 | 30 | 83.3 (65.3–94.5) | 96.7 (82.8–99.9) |
| 25–30 | 14 | 57.1 (28.9–82.3) | 92.9 (66.1–99.8) |
| >30 | 17 | 5.9 (1.5–28.7) | 35.3 (14.2–61.7) |
| Overall | 110 | 72.7 (63.4–80.8) | 86.4 (78.5–92.1) |
Sensitivities are provided with their 95% confidence intervals.
The Ct values were determined for NP samples using the RT-PCR developed by the National Institute of Infectious Diseases, Japan.
AN, anterior nasal; Ct, cycle threshold; NP, nasopharyngeal; RT-PCR, reverse-transcription polymerase chain reaction.
